Output 0398a25074fea55a442170ffa4819707cb607f300073551973ab854f37e28dbc:29

value
381109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4570507fb893cc8265ee2fc14a9d5ce0d415913 OP_EQUAL
address
3M3mRSfVjySgpxAXy9t3VArADfbWyhmJSN
transaction
0398a25074fea55a442170ffa4819707cb607f300073551973ab854f37e28dbc
confirmations
209898
spent
true